The Netherlands has over 121,000 millionaires

Despite the recession, the number of millionaires in the Netherlands went up almost 15% last year to 121,700, according to the 2010 World Wealth Report drawn up by Merill Lynch and Capgemini, quoted by Nos tv.


The new millionaires are people who had assets and have benefited from rising share prices or who invested in renting out property, the report says.
But 14 people in the Netherlands became millionaires last year because they won the lottery, Nos tv points out.
The report defines a millionaire as having ‘$1 million or more, excluding primary residence, collectibles, consumables, and consumer durables’.
